Abstract

Article Information The quantitative study investigated the relationship between AI trust and attitudes toward AI among university college students. An adapted questionnaire was utilized. Data were gathered through Google Forms, where the respondents were selected using a stratified random sampling technique. Validity and reliability tests were employed using Cronbach's Alpha and Average Variance Extracted. Descriptive statistics were used to describe the variables and subcomponents in the study, while bootstrapping analysis was conducted through SmartPLS 4.0 to assess the hypothesized model. The results demonstrated that college students showed a moderate level of AI trust and attitude toward AI and confirmed the significant relationship between the predictor (AI trust) and outcome (attitude toward AI) constructs.
